Toshiba Tec and Intersport get Champions League Final Payday

Toshiba subsidiary to supply point of sales solutions for Madrid final

The Champions League final has surpassed the NFL Superbowl as the world's most popular annual sporting event

Toshiba Tecwill provide a complete electronic Point of Sale (POS) solution to sports retailer Intersport which will allow it to handle an estimated half a million customers ahead of the hotly anticipated UEFA Champions League Final.

With the final being hosted at Real Madrid’s Santiago Bernabéu stadium, Intersport will be setting up temporary merchandising stores all over the Spanish capital, using POS solutions provided by the Toshiba subsidiary.

Eric Dauchy, spokesman at Toshiba Tec, explained that the company’s POS solutions are straightforward “plug and play” products, which will help Intersport’s IT team install and network the products at their temporary locations.

In addition to a 350 square metre Fan Zone inside the Bernabeu stadium, Intersport will set up 14 temporary merchandising stores in Madrid and additional merchandising stores at Valdebebas and Getafe where the European Under-21 and Women’s finals will be played.

The agreement extends from the deal that Toshiba Tec signed with Intersport to provide POS solutions for the Euro 2008 European Football Championship Finals in Switzerland and Austria in 2008. Dauchy said that the deal also extends to all UEFA football matches played in Spain and Germany and various other European countries.

This year’s Champions League final will be contested between German giants Bayern Munich and Jose Mourinho’s Inter Milan. Carlos Camaros, sales director at Toshiba Tec Spain, said that the firm was “very proud” to be involved in the world’s most-watched annual sports event, after last year’s Champion’s League final surpassed the NFL Superbowl in viewing figures.
